Show Prompt Action of Bayard NEW YORK March 17 James R Beard Secretary of the Central South American Telegraph Company states he has received advices to the effect that the authorities of Mexico San Salvador and Nicaragua have posted guards at the cable landings of that company and the following telegram from Secretary of State Bayard shows the United States government is determined to protect American property from injury Washington March 16 1885 JAMES A SCRVMSER President Central and South American Telegraph Co New York A telegram was today sent to the United States legation at Guatemala holding that republic responsible for injuries in-juries by its authority or with its connivance con-nivance to cables or other interests of United States citizens in Central America The Wachusctt is now en route to La union to be duly instructed Signed BAYARD |
